The South East of Ireland is a good place for tech firms to invest in. It is a huge benefit to Ireland also as Tech firms in the South of Ireland are huge employers and bring a large amount of foreign direct investment (FDI). When it comes to FDI Ireland was the number one choice for US companies in 2021. In my opinion, there are three main reasons why the South East of Ireland is so attractive for tech firms to invest in. Examples of some of the biggest tech firms that have invested in the South of Ireland are Apple and Dell. 1. Low Corporate Tax Rate – Ireland has one of the lowest corporate tax rates in Europe at 12.5% which is very low compared to the UK which is 25%.
